Instructions
Prepare ingredients
Dice: 1(3 ½oz) red onion and 500 g(1lb) chicken breastHalve: 250 g(9oz) cherry tomatoes
Add 500 g(1lb) chicken breast to 2 tbsp cornflour. Toss to coat. Set aside.
Add 300 g(10 ½oz) silken tofu, 45 ml(3tablespoon) lemon juice, 1 tbsp dried oregano, 1 tbsp dried thyme, 1 tbsp dried dill, 4 cloves garlic, Salt and pepper to a blender or stick blender or food processor and blitz until smooth.
Cook
In a large and deep pan, heat the 10 ml(2teaspoon) extra virgin olive oil over medium heat and add 500 g(1lb) chicken breast. Cook until the outside is mostly white.
Add 500 ml(2cups) chicken stock, sauce mixture and 350 g(2cups) orzo / risoni to a pan and allow the liquid to come to the boil. Once bubbling, reduce the heat and cover for 10 minutes or until orzo is tender. Stir occassionally.
Lift lid and add 250 g(9oz) cherry tomatoes, 1(3 ½oz) red onion, 300 g(10 oz) spinach. Stir until combined and spinach has wilted (if meal prepping, no need to worry about wilting spinach)
Serve.

Notes
Note 1 - Silken Tofu You can substitute with yoghurt or other cream/dairy product. Just note it may split in the heating process. StoringLet cool at room temperature for no more than 2 hours then store in airtight containers in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.ReheatingAdd a splash of water, milk (or even yoghurt/cream) before reheating. Don't stir before reheating as it can fall apart. Microwave. Reheat individual portions in the microwave on 1 minute intervals, stirring after each interval. This should take 2-3 minutes.Stovetop. You can also reheat on stovetop over medium heat until warmed through (approx. 10 minutes)
